Senior Data Engineer
Job Summary
AboutMealSuite
MealSuitebuilds end-to-end foodservice technology for healthcare and senior living organizations. Our mission is to help care teams deliver better dining experiences with less fast-growing team working on meaningful problems that directlyimpactpatient and resident care.
About the Role
We are seeking aSenior Data Engineerto design build andoperatethe data systems that power analytics and AI across theMealSuiteplatform. This role will focus on bringing together data from multiple systems and making it consistent reliable and easy to use.
You will take ownership of data pipelines core data models and integrations across SaaS platforms and internal systems. You will work closely with Engineering Product and Analytics to solve data challenges and ensure the business can rely on shared data for reporting and decision-making.
WhatYoullDo
Design build and maintain data pipelines that ingest and unify data from SaaS platforms APIs and internal systems
Build and improve ELT/ETL workflows and support a reliable well-structured data warehouse
Develop and maintain consistent data models and definitions across core business entities
Improve pipeline reliability through testing monitoring alerting and automated issue resolution
Work with technical and business stakeholders to solve data integration challenges and improve data trust
Support strong data practices across data quality documentation governance and warehouse operations
Lead integration work across systems such as Salesforce and other key business platforms
Contribute to data architecture decisions and help establish consistent engineering practices
What You Bring
5 years of experience building and maintaining data pipelines across multiple systems and platforms
Strong experience with SQL for data transformation validation and modeling
Hands-on experience with Python (or similar) and API-based data integration
Experience designing and operating ELT/ETL workflows and supporting a data warehouse in production
Experience working with cloud data platforms and modern data management practices
Experience improving data reliability through monitoring alerting testing and troubleshooting
Experience working with evolving schemas and maintaining structured analytics-ready datasets
Comfortable using version control (Git) and working in a collaborative code-reviewed environment
Ability to solve ambiguous data problems and work effectively with both technical and non-technical stakeholders
WhyYoullLove Working Here
Unlimited paid time off we trust our employees to create balance
Retirement savings support RRSP/401(k) matching at 100% up to 3%
Health benefits medical dental vision life & disability insurance and paid parental leave starting day one
Hybrid flexibility balance in-person collaboration with remote work
Work-life balance 90% of employees feel supported by their leaders
Equity program participation share inMealSuitesgrowth
Career development opportunities we support your long-term goals
Purpose-driven work our mission aligns with the values of 90% of employees
Compensation
$110000 - $135000 USD
$115000 - $140000 CAD
Additional Information
We want to ensure that every qualified individual has an equal opportunity to work with us. If you require accommodation during our application process please contact us at.
MealSuiteuses AI-assisted tools during parts of the hiring process including screening and workflow automation. All final hiring decisions are made by people. This is a current vacancy and we are actively hiring for this position.
Required Experience:
Senior IC
About Company
MealSuiteĀ® is a fully integrated, all-in-one foodservice management technology that empowers care communities to improve their operations and enhance mealtime experience for their patients, residents and staff.